The building segment in the wireless mobile dehumidifier market is a significant contributor to the overall demand, primarily driven by the increasing need to protect residential and commercial structures from moisture-related damage. In buildings, high humidity levels can lead to a variety of issues, including mold growth, wood rot, and the degradation of building materials. Wireless mobile dehumidifiers are effective in controlling these issues by maintaining optimal humidity levels. These devices can be easily moved between different rooms and floors, offering flexibility in usage. With smart connectivity features, they can be controlled remotely, which makes them highly suitable for modern homes and buildings with advanced technology systems.
In addition to mold prevention, wireless mobile dehumidifiers in buildings help improve indoor air quality, thereby enhancing comfort for inhabitants. The growing trend of smart homes and connected devices is also expected to increase the adoption of wireless dehumidifiers. These devices are particularly useful in areas with high humidity, such as basements or regions with a tropical climate. As the demand for energy-efficient appliances rises, the wireless mobile dehumidifier market for buildings is anticipated to experience robust growth, as these devices offer superior performance with lower energy consumption compared to traditional models.

The chemical processing industry is highly sensitive to environmental conditions, and moisture control is critical for maintaining the quality of chemical products and preventing hazardous reactions. In chemical manufacturing, excess humidity can lead to product degradation, corrosion of equipment, and the risk of chemical spills or reactions. Wireless mobile dehumidifiers are increasingly being used in chemical processing plants to maintain optimal humidity levels, ensuring that chemical reactions take place under controlled conditions and minimizing the risk of accidents.
These dehumidifiers are often used in areas where moisture could interfere with the stability of raw materials or finished products. The flexibility of wireless mobile dehumidifiers allows them to be deployed in various sections of the plant or warehouse as needed. By providing real-time monitoring and adjustments via wireless technology, these devices help chemical companies maintain strict environmental controls and improve the efficiency of production processes. As the chemical industry focuses on improving safety and product quality, the demand for portable and efficient dehumidification solutions is expected to continue to grow.

How do wireless mobile dehumidifiers work?
These devices work by drawing in humid air, removing moisture through condensation, and releasing dry air back into the environment. The wireless connectivity allows users to monitor and adjust settings remotely.
